| Package | Description |
|---|---|
| software.amazon.awssdk.services.glue |
|
| software.amazon.awssdk.services.glue.model |
| Modifier and Type | Method and Description |
|---|---|
default UpdateCrawlerResponse |
GlueClient.updateCrawler(Consumer<UpdateCrawlerRequest.Builder> updateCrawlerRequest)
Updates a crawler.
|
default CompletableFuture<UpdateCrawlerResponse> |
GlueAsyncClient.updateCrawler(Consumer<UpdateCrawlerRequest.Builder> updateCrawlerRequest)
Updates a crawler.
|
| Modifier and Type | Method and Description |
|---|---|
static U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.builder() |
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.classifiers(Collection<String> classifiers)
A list of custom classifiers that the user has registered.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.classifiers(String... classifiers)
A list of custom classifiers that the user has registered.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.configuration(String configuration)
Crawler configuration information.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.crawlerSecurityConfiguration(String crawlerSecurityConfiguration)
The name of the
SecurityConfiguration structure to be used by this crawler. |
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.databaseName(String databaseName)
The Glue database where results are stored, such as:
arn:aws:daylight:us-east-1::database/sometable/*. |
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.description(String description)
A description of the new crawler.
|
default U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.lakeFormationConfiguration(Consumer<LakeFormationConfiguration.Builder> lakeFormationConfiguration)
Specifies Lake Formation configuration settings for the crawler.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.lakeFormationConfiguration(LakeFormationConfiguration lakeFormationConfiguration)
Specifies Lake Formation configuration settings for the crawler.
|
default U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.lineageConfiguration(Consumer<LineageConfiguration.Builder> lineageConfiguration)
Specifies data lineage configuration settings for the crawler.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.lineageConfiguration(LineageConfiguration lineageConfiguration)
Specifies data lineage configuration settings for the crawler.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.name(String name)
Name of the new crawler.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.overrideConfiguration(AwsRequestOverrideConfiguration overrideConfiguration) |
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.overrideConfiguration(Consumer<AwsRequestOverrideConfiguration.Builder> builderConsumer) |
default U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.recrawlPolicy(Consumer<RecrawlPolicy.Builder> recrawlPolicy)
A policy that specifies whether to crawl the entire dataset again, or to crawl only folders that were added
since the last crawler run.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.recrawlPolicy(RecrawlPolicy recrawlPolicy)
A policy that specifies whether to crawl the entire dataset again, or to crawl only folders that were added
since the last crawler run.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.role(String role)
The IAM role or Amazon Resource Name (ARN) of an IAM role that is used by the new crawler to access customer
resources.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.schedule(String schedule)
A
cron expression used to specify the schedule (see Time-Based Schedules
for Jobs and Crawlers. |
default U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.schemaChangePolicy(Consumer<SchemaChangePolicy.Builder> schemaChangePolicy)
The policy for the crawler's update and deletion behavior.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.schemaChangePolicy(SchemaChangePolicy schemaChangePolicy)
The policy for the crawler's update and deletion behavior.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.tablePrefix(String tablePrefix)
The table prefix used for catalog tables that are created.
|
default U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.targets(Consumer<CrawlerTargets.Builder> targets)
A list of targets to crawl.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.Builder.targets(CrawlerTargets targets)
A list of targets to crawl.
|
UpdateCrawlerRequest.Builder |
UpdateCrawlerRequest.toBuilder() |
| Modifier and Type | Method and Description |
|---|---|
static Class<? extends UpdateCrawlerRequest.Builder> |
UpdateCrawlerRequest.serializableBuilderClass() |
Copyright © 2023. All rights reserved.